The South Carolina Law Enforcement Division is investigating a deadly officer-involved shooting in Dorchester.

The Dorchester County Sheriff's Office said a deputy shot a burglary suspect early Thursday morning. According to investigators, deputies responded to an armed burglary just after midnight.

The person shot was taken to a local hospital but later died from their injuries. Their identity hasn't been released.

Dorchester County Sheriff Sam Richardson requested that SLED take over the lead investigative role, which is standard procedure for officer-involved shootings in South Carolina. Sheriff Richardson is scheduled to hold a media briefing Thursday afternoon to provide further details.

This is the 21st officer-involved shooting in South Carolina this year. In 2025, there were 45 officer involved shootings in South Carolina.
